Dunkin Donuts Cinnamon Stick Nutrition Facts

Nutrition facts and Weight Watchers points for Cinnamon Stick from Dunkin Donuts.

Calories

There are 380 calories in Cinnamon Stick.

380

Nutrition Facts

Serving Size ?
Calories 380
Calories From Fat 220
Amount Per Serving % Daily Value*
Total Fat 25g 38%
Saturated Fat 12.0g 60%
Trans Fat 0.0g  
Cholesterol 30mg 10%
Sodium 370mg 15%
Total Carbohydrates 35g 12%
Dietary Fiber 1g 4%
Sugars 13g  
Protein 4g 8%
Vitamin A   0%
Vitamin C   0%
Calcium   4%
Iron   8%

*All percent daily value figures are based on a 2,000 calorie diet.

Nutritional information source: Dunkin Donuts

Allergens

Contains egg milk soy wheat
Unknown fish glutamates gluten MSG mustard nitrates peanuts seeds sesame shellfish sulfites tree nuts

Allergy Information: a Dunkin Donuts Cinnamon Stick contains egg, milk, soy and wheat.

* Please keep in mind that most fast food restaurants cannot guarantee that any product is free of allergens as they use shared equipment for prepping foods.

Disadvantages:

  1. Calories: It’s important to note that the Dunkin Donuts Cinnamon Stick is a high-calorie treat. With 380 calories per serving, it should be enjoyed in moderation as part of a balanced diet. Most of those calories come from fat (59%) and carbohydrates (37%). If you’re watching your calorie intake or following a strict diet, it’s important to consider the nutritional content of this treat.
  2. Allergen Information: The Cinnamon Stick contains ingredients such as egg, milk, soy and wheat. Individuals with allergies or dietary restrictions should exercise caution and review the allergen information provided by Dunkin Donuts. It’s worth noting that cross-contamination can occur in fast food establishments, as shared equipment is often used to prepare food.
